Transaction 3f9d8bc991df9e01e84745b4555c8cbcd4d4ecbdd100f56581284034409e7a8a

block
e496d090c2b4c8b508044cc21acf516d241fb8d02de6d13989418d129413db93

1 Input

24 Outputs